Trinidad and Tobago - Re-Export of Parts of Taps, Cocks, Valves or Similar Appliances

Since 2014, Trinidad and Tobago Re-Export of Parts of Taps, Cocks, Valves or Similar Appliances fell by 7.7%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 14 among other countries in Re-Export of Parts of Taps, Cocks, Valves or Similar Appliances at $363,462. Trinidad and Tobago is overtaken by Bahamas, which was ranked number 13 with $409,345 and is followed by Jordan at $213,063.55. United States topped the ranking with $374,153,100.02 in 2019, a growth of 2.3% compared to 2018. United Arab Emirates, Canada and Italy resp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Pakistan witnessed the best average annual growth at +170.1% per year, while Moldova witnessed the worst performance at -65.3% per year.
